LITTLETON – Robby Witwer scored twice in the third period on Saturday note as Mullen broke open a scoreless tie for a 3-1 victory over Chatfield at The Edge.
The Mustangs moved to 6-2 overall, 2-2 in the Highlands Conference. Chatfield is 2-7-2, 0-5.
It was the second consecutive game for the Mustangs against the Chargers – they also played a week ago, on Jan. 5, with Mullen winning 2-1 in the opener to the scheduling quirk.
The game had been scoreless through two periods despite the fact that the Mustangs had outshot the Chargers 33-16, including 22-8 in the first period.
However, Witwer, John Baird and Utah Bryant would connect for three scores.
First, Witwer scored at 6:16 of the final period off assists from Baird and Bryant. Bryant upped it to 2-0 at 13:31 on an assist from Baird. And Witwer added his second score on an assist from Bryant.
All three goals came at even strength.
Chatfield finally got one past Mustangs junior goalie Hunter Mahon inside the final 2 minutes of the game.
The Mustangs will have three consecutive nonconference games this week. On Thursday, Jan. 19, they will be home against Colorado Springs’ Doherty at The Edge, a matinee at 2:30 p.m. It will be followed by a trip to the mountains for a Friday matchup against Summit, 6:30 p.m., and Saturday at Steamboat Springs, 4:30 p.m.
